Mathias Timmermans is a designer, strategist, community builder and facilitator. With a background in the arts, he has been working at the intersection of culture, communication and social change for more than 25 years.
His career began at LUCA School of Arts (master degrees Graphic Design and Fine Arts) continued through Kunstencentrum Vooruit (now VierNulVier) Brugge Plus and Ghent European Youth Capital, as well as change-oriented projects for organisations including Kunst in Huis. As an art director, concept developer and project coordinator, he has worked for Flemish and international organisations, cities and artists. His projects have included Jong Volk, Kookeet, Theater aan Zee, Le Grand Mix, Jazz Bilzen and the artists’ collective The Distillery.
